Key Responsibilities:
- General surgical pathology and cytopathology sign-out
- Frozen section interpretation and intraoperative consultation
- Participation in quality initiatives, tumor boards, and clinical case discussions
- Collaborative engagement with hospital medical staff and laboratory team
Qualifications:
- Medical Degree (MD or DO) from an accredited institution
- AP/CP Board Certification or Eligibility
- Tennessee medical license or eligibility required
- Excellent diagnostic and communication skills
- Team-oriented approach and interest in professional development
